GB 17761-2024 Safety technical specification for electric bicycle 1 Scope This document specifies technical requirements such as bicycle identification, bicycle safety, mechanical safety, electrical safety, fire and flame retardant, plastic proportion, BDS positioning function, communication and dynamic safety monitoring, tamper-proof, instruction manual, enterprise quality assurance capability and product consistency of electric bicycles, and describes the corresponding test methods. This document is applicable to electric bicycles. 2 Normative references The following documents contain requirements which, through reference in this text, constitute provisions of this document. For dated references, only the edition cited applies. For undated references, the latest edition of the referenced document (including any amendments) applies. GB/T 755-2019 Rotating electrical machines - Rating and performance GB 811 Helmets for motorcycle and electric bicycle users GB/T 3565.1-2022 Safety requirements for bicycles - Part 1: Terms and definitions GB 3565.2-2022 Safety requirements for bicycles - Part 2: Requirements for city and trekking, young adult, mountain and racing bicycles GB/T 3565.4-2022 Safety requirements for bicycles - Part 4: Braking test methods GB/T 4208-2017 Degrees of protection provided by enclosure (IP code) GB/T 5169.16 Fire hazard testing for electric and electronic products - Part 16: Test flames - 50W horizontal and vertical flame test methods GB/T 5296.1 Instructions for use of products of consumer interest - Part 1: General principles GB/T 5454 Textiles - Burning behaviour - Oxygen index method GB/T 5455 Textiles - Burning behaviour - Determination of damaged length, afterglow time and afterflame time of vertically oriented specimens GB/T 12742 The specifications of testing equipment and measuring appliance for bicycle GB/T 18284 QR code GB/T 18380.12 Test on electric and optical fibre cables under fire conditions - Part 12:Test for vertical flame propagation for a single insulated wire or cable - Procedure for 1kW pre-mixed flame GB/T 18380.22 Tests on electric and optical fibre cables under fire conditions - Part 22: test for vertical flame propagation for a single small insulated wire or cable - Procedure for diffusion flame GB/T 31887.1-2019 Cycles - Lighting and retro-reflective devices - Part 1: Lighting and light signalling devices GB/T 31887.2 Cycles - Lighting and retro-reflective devices - Part 2: Retro-Reflective devices GB 38262-2019 Flammability of interior materials for buses GB/T 40302 Plastics - Determination of burning behaviour of thin flexible vertical specimens in contact with a small-flame ignition source GB 42295-2022 Safety requirement for electric bicycles electrical GB 42296 Safety technical requirements of charger for electric bicycles GB 43854 Safety technical specification of lithium-ion battery for electric bicycle QB/T 1880 Front forks for bicycles 3 Terms, definitions and abbreviations 3.1 Terms and definitions For the purposes of this document, the terms and definitions given in GB/T 3565.1-2022 and the following apply. 3.1.1 electric bicycle two-wheeled bicycle with battery as energy source to realize electric drive or/and electric aid functions 3.1.2 fully assembled electric bicycle electric bicycle equipped with all necessary components (including battery and all accessories expressly indicated in the instruction manual, but excluding external charger and helmet) (3.1.1) 3.1.3 electric drive drive mode in which the driving electric energy is supplied by the on-board battery and only the motor outputs power 3.1.4 electric aid drive mode consisting of manpower and motor power according to the output ratio 3.1.5 manufactured date production date date of completion of bicycle manufacturing 3.1.6 BeiDou navigation satellite system; BDS global satellite navigation system developed, constructed and managed by China, which provides users with real-time three-dimensional position, speed and time information Note 1: It is referred to as BDS in this document. Note 2: The services provided by BDS include basic navigation services, short message communication services, satellite-based enhancement services, international search and rescue services and precision single-point positioning services. [Source: GB/T 39267-2020, 2.1.11, modified] 3.1.7 BeiDou independent positioning function that realizes the satellite navigation, positioning, timing and other functions only by using BDS without relying on other satellite navigation systems 3.2 Abbreviations For the purposes of this document, the following abbreviations apply. PDOP: Position Dilution of Precision 4G: the 4th Generation mobile communication technology 5G: the 5th Generation mobile communication technology 4 General requirements 4.1 In the case of normal use, reasonable and foreseeable misuse and failure, the electric bicycles shall guard against danger. Dangers include but are not limited to: a) material deterioration, fire or personnel burns by the heat generated; b) burning, explosion, electric shock and the like during charging, driving and parking; c) personal injury caused by the breakage, looseness, deformation and motion interference of the bicycle or its components. 4.2 The software and hardware of electric bicycles shall have tamper-proof design to prevent unauthorized modification or change of maximum speed, motor power, voltage, etc.
